NCPC BOSS commends Okowa for sponsoring pilgrims to Holy Land

By Joyce Remi-Babayeju

The Executive Secretary, Nigerian Christian Pilgrim Commission, Rev Dr Yakubu Pam has commended the Executive Governor of Delta State, Dr Ifeanyi Okowa for his consistency in sponsoring Christians on Pilgrimage to the Holy land.
Rev. Pam who was represented by the Director of Mobilization , Chris Udegbunam gave the commendation on 8th August, 2022 during the orientation programme organized by NCPC for intending pilgrims at the Government House, Asaba.

He said ,” my special thanks go to the Executive Governor of Delta State,, His Excellency,Dr Ifeanyi Okowa for his consistency in the sponsorship of christians in the state on Pilgrimage and for advancing the cause of Christianity Pilgrimage in Nigeria.

The NCPC boss also congratulated the intending pilgrims for their level of preparedness both spiritually and physically to embark on the journey of Faith and enjoined them to shun abscondment and warned that the
Commission frowns seriously at it and would do everything humanly possible to discourage it.
He further applauded Governor Okowa for being the only State Chief Executive in South South who sponsored pilgrims to the Kingdom of Jordan in 2021.
Chairman of the Delta State Christian Pilgrims Welfare Board, Most Rev Cyril Odutemu admonished the intending pilgrims to conduct themselves properly while in the Holy land nothing that the Board would not tolerate any form of unruly behavior in the Holy land.
He further advised them not to do anything that would undermine the security of the Host County. Executive Secretary of the Delta State Christian Pilgrims Welfare Board, Apostle Samuel Okoh, charged the intending pilgrims to be good ambassadors of the state and Nigeria .

About 315 intending pilgrims of Delta State were airlifted to the Holy land of Israel and Jordan
Monday 8th, August, 2022 from the Port Harcourt International Airport.
